SOCAR supplies Azerbaijani regions with gas

Azerbaijan, Baku, Sept.25 / Trend, E.Ismayilov /

In the near future, the Azerigaz Production Association of the State Oil Company of Azerbaijan (SOCAR) plans to start gas supplies to a number of settlements in the Masalli and Lankaran regions of Azerbaijan (235 and 270 kilometres from Baku, respectively), the Production Association told Trend on Tuesday.

At present, SOCAR is actively working to improve the level of gasification in Azerbaijan. In particular, the level in the country is projected to reach 95 per cent in 2013.

To realise the set plans, the Azerigaz Production Association which deals with gas transportation and distribution in Azerbaijan is working to improve the level of gas supply throughout the country.

According to the report, the relevant work has been done on the gasification of several villages and connection of new subscribers within improvements with the gas provision level in the Masalli and Lankaran regions.

"Much work has been done. As a result, the gas supply to a significant number of subscribers who live in these regions of the country will start in the near future," a source in Production Association said.

As of Sept.1, the number of gas users in Azerbaijan was 1.429 million. Some 1.411 of the total number of subscribers accounts for a population group and 17,533 other subscribers.

Some 645,264 of the total number of gas customers account for Baku (635,884 - population), 783,993 subscribers (775,840 - population) in other regions of the country.
